Spruce Tree Removal in San Jose, CA
Spruce tree removal services involve the careful and efficient removal of unwanted or hazardous spruce trees from residential properties. This service covers a variety of projects, including removing dead or diseased trees, clearing space for new landscaping, or addressing safety concerns caused by unstable or overgrown spruces. Property owners typically seek this service to improve the safety and appearance of their yards, prevent potential property damage, or comply with local regulations regarding tree management.
Before requesting spruce tree removal, property owners should consider the size and location of the tree, as well as any potential obstacles such as nearby structures or power lines. Understanding the condition of the tree and its proximity to other landscape features can help determine the most appropriate removal approach. Additionally, it is helpful to be aware of any permits or regulations that may apply in the area to ensure the project proceeds smoothly and in compliance with local guidelines.

Spruce Tree Removal Questions
When should a spruce tree be removed? Removal is recommended if the tree shows signs of disease, damage, or poses a safety risk to the property.
What are common reasons for removing a spruce tree? Common reasons include disease, pest infestation, structural instability, or construction projects nearby.
How can I tell if my spruce tree needs removal? Indicators include dead or dying branches, extensive decay, leaning, or visible damage to the trunk.
What should property owners consider before removing a spruce tree? Consider the tree’s location, size, and potential impact on surrounding structures or landscaping.
